George Russell breaks silence on Lewis Hamilton incident

George Russell has shed some light on the incident that occurred between him and his Mercedes teammate, Lewis Hamilton, during qualifying for the Spanish Grand Prix.  The collision took place when both drivers were starting their flying laps at the end of the Q2 session, with Hamilton benefitting from the slipstream down the pit straight. As Hamilton closed in, Russell moved towards the left side of the track, resulting in damage to Hamilton's front wing and catching the seven-time world champion off guard.  Russell promptly apologised over the radio, but both drivers were perplexed about how the incident unfolded.
